Nestled in the heart of Singapore's Central Water Catchment, the MacRitchie Reservoir Boardwalk is a premier hiking area that offers visitors an oasis of nature and tranquility. Spanning approximately 11 kilometers, the boardwalk weaves through lush forests, providing an immersive experience in the rich biodiversity of the region. As you stroll along the elevated boardwalk, you'll be treated to stunning views of the reservoir, where you can spot various bird species, monkeys, and other wildlife in their natural habitat. The reservoir itself is not just a beautiful sight; it also serves as a vital water catchment area for the city. Enthusiasts of all ages will appreciate the well-maintained trails that accommodate both leisurely walks and more rigorous hikes. The MacRitchie Reservoir is the ideal place for those looking to escape the bustling city life, offering a peaceful retreat into nature where you can unwind and recharge. Be sure to keep your camera handy, as the vibrant flora and fauna make for excellent photo opportunities. For those who enjoy physical activities, the area is popular for kayaking and canoeing, allowing visitors to experience the reservoir from a different perspective. Local tips
- Visit early in the morning for a peaceful experience and to avoid the midday heat.
- Bring sufficient water and snacks, as there are limited facilities within the area.
- Wear comfortable hiking shoes, as some trails may be uneven or muddy.
- Keep an eye out for wildlife, especially the monkeys, but do not feed them.
- Consider visiting during weekdays to avoid crowds and enjoy a more serene environment.
